On September 9, 2008, the Baltic bank group Danske Bank, the International trade union federation UNI Global, its sectoral federation, UNI Finance, and six national trade unions (*) signed, in Copenhagen, an international framework agreement to promote and guarantee workers' rights throughout all its subsidiaries. This agreement, which will concern about 24.000 workers, will be applicable in all the companies directly controlled by the group, i.e. those in which Danske Bank owns a majority of the capital or a majority of voting rights, or even where it appoints more than half the members of the management or administrative bodies.
Content of the agreement. The group notably commits to:
- Respect the freedom of association, to bargain bona fide and to honor agreement signed with the trade unions;
